I want to install java stack on Server for adobe document service configuration.
I want to connect JAVA stack to ABAP stack after installing JAVA stack.
My ABAP stack is ECC 6.0 so Would you be so kind to tell me which Netweaver Version need to prefer for Installation.

To reiterate what the others have said, you will want to install ADS on a separate instance, as dual-stack is not supported anymore except for a few exceptions (e.g., Solution Manager).
That gives you some freedom, however. You don't have to exactly match your ADS version to your ECC version, but your ADS version should be at least as high as your ECC version. It can be higher.
So, if you're running ECC 6.0 without enhancement packs, that means you need to install a NetWeaver AS Java system of at least 7.00. 7.01 or 7.02 should also work.
